A striped racer, also known as the California whipsnake, is a species of non-venomous snake native to the coast and foothills of California. It is a long, slender, and fast-moving snake, identified by its distinctive stripes running down the length of its body. They primarily feed on lizards and small rodents. The scientific name for this species is Masticophis lateralis.

Dual racing in Mountain Biking. New format of racing where two riders race head to head on a short predominantly downhill course made up of various obstacles with the first across the line being deemed the winner. A series of knock out heats lead to a head to head final between the fastest riders.
